Medical Officer positions in Pakistan offer promising career opportunities for qualified healthcare professionals. These roles are available across various government and private institutions, including the Ministry of National Health Services, Sindh Public Service Commission (SPSC), Pakistan Atomic Energy Commission (PAEC), and Combined Military Hospital (CMH) Rawalpindi. Positions such as Women Medical Officer (BPS-17), General Duty Medical Officer (GDMO), and Consultant Doctors are among the available roles. 

Applicants are typically required to hold an MBBS degree from a recognized institution, possess valid registration with the Pakistan Medical Commission (PMC), and have completed a one-year house job. Age limits and experience requirements vary depending on the specific position and organization.These positions offer competitive salaries, ranging from PKR 70,000 to PKR 150,000 per month, along with benefits such as health insurance, annual increments, and job security under government employment.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need experience to apply for Medical Officer jobs in the government sector?

Most Medical Officer jobs require at least a one-year house job, but fresh MBBS graduates with valid PMC registration can apply too, especially for BPS-17 positions.

Can I apply if I’m still waiting for my PMC registration?

Unfortunately, no. Your application will only be considered complete once you have a valid and active PMC registration.

Are female doctors encouraged to apply?

Absolutely! Many departments have special quotas or positions reserved for Women Medical Officers to ensure equal representation.

Is it necessary to apply through the National Job Portal (NJP)?

Only for federal government jobs like those under the Ministry of National Health Services. Other departments may use their own websites or postal applications.
